My experience with special needs children...
While supporting nonverbal children on the autism spectrum, I focused on creating a welcoming and safe environment. I worked on simple but meaningful activities, such as recognizing colors and learning their names, progressing gradually to writing their own names. It’s a process that takes time, but with patience and consistency, meaningful progress can be achieved.
